Attractions and Places To See around Coswig (Anhalt) - Top 20

Best attractions and places to see around Coswig (Anhalt) include historical landmarks, cultural sites, and natural areas. Situated on the Elbe River, the town is within the UNESCO Biosphere Reserve Middle Elbe and near the Fläming Nature Park. Its history, dating back to the 12th century, is reflected in its architecture and points of interest. The region offers diverse opportunities for exploring both historical sites and natural landscapes.

April 13, 2024, All Saints' Church (Schlosskirche), Wittenberg

The Castle Church is located in the west of the old town of Wittenberg at the end of the Castle Street coming from the market. It is structurally connected to Wittenberg Castle and forms the northern side wing of the castle's three-wing complex, which is open to the east. Access to the church is via its north side. The church is not strictly oriented towards the east. Its longitudinal axis deviates from the east direction by about 14 degrees to the south. Source https://de.wikipedia.org/wiki/Schlosskirche_(Lutherstadt_Wittenberg)

The church was built between 1490 and 1515 and has since formed a wing of the castle. The 88 meter high tower with its neo-Gothic tower dome from the years 1885/1892 can be seen from afar. The church became famous through the 97 theses of Luther posted on October 31, 1517.

Frequently Asked Questions

What historical landmarks can I explore in Coswig (Anhalt)?

Coswig (Anhalt) is rich in history. You can visit the impressive St. Nicholas Church with its 52-meter tower, the historic Town Hall with Market Square, and the picturesque Coswig Castle, which dates back to the 12th century. Don't miss the Bismarck Tower near Wörpen for its historical grandeur, or the Thießen Hammer Mill, an architectural monument showcasing technical refinement.

Are there any significant cultural sites to visit in Coswig (Anhalt)?

Yes, Coswig (Anhalt) offers several cultural sites. The Klosterhof with City Museum, housed in a former Augustinian nunnery, provides insights into the town's past and hosts municipal events. Nearby, a renovated garden house features an exhibition on Romanticism. The St. Michael Church, extensively renovated, is also notable for its barrier-free design.

What natural attractions are there to see around Coswig (Anhalt)?

Coswig (Anhalt) is surrounded by natural beauty. Its location on the Elbe River offers picturesque scenery, and you can explore the Elbe Lowlands. The town is situated within the UNESCO Biosphere Reserve Middle Elbe and near the Fläming Nature Park, both offering diverse ecosystems. The Saarenbruch-Matzwerder is also a nature reserve within the area.

Are there cycling routes available around Coswig (Anhalt)?

Yes, Coswig (Anhalt) is an excellent starting point for cycling. The Elbe Cycle Route passes through the area, offering scenic rides. You can cycle along the Elbdamm in a historical atmosphere, passing highlights like the Sieglitzer Park Gate. Other routes include the Jagdbrücke over the River Mulde – Castle Gate (Sieglitzer Park) loop.

What water-based activities can I do on the Elbe River?

The Elbe River provides opportunities for various water-based activities. You can enjoy picturesque views from the riverbanks, cross the river on a reaction ferry, or embark on paddle adventures to discover the Middle Elbe Biosphere Reserve from the water. The Hunting Bridge over the Mulde is also a great spot to observe large salmon trout.

Are there any lesser-known or unique spots worth discovering?

For a glimpse into medieval tranquility, seek out the Wahlsdorfer Ziehbrunnen (draw-well). The historic Unterfischerei Neighborhood is also a charming area known for its Mediterranean flair and old streets, offering a unique local experience away from the main tourist paths.
